[PATCH v2 56/59] x86/ftrace: Remove ftrace_epilogue()

From: Peter Zijlstra
Date: Fri Sep 02 2022 - 10:31:04 EST


From: Peter Zijlstra <peterz@xxxxxxxxxxxxx>

Remove the weird jumps to RET and simply use RET.

This then promotes ftrace_stub() to a real function; which becomes
important for kcfi.
